Cordless vs. Pneumatic Nailers
Choosing between a cordless and pneumatic 15-gauge finish nailer hinges on your workflow and project demands. Pneumatic nailers, powered by air compressors, deliver consistent, high-force driving capability ideal for extended use in large-scale projects like framing or installing crown molding. They’re lighter due to the absence of a battery, reducing hand fatigue during long sessions. However, they require a compressor and hose, which can limit mobility and add setup time. If your workspace is fixed and you prioritize power and precision, a pneumatic model is a reliable choice.
Cordless 15-gauge finish nailers, on the other hand, offer unparalleled freedom of movement, making them perfect for jobsites without easy access to power or for tasks requiring frequent repositioning. Modern lithium-ion batteries provide ample runtime for most projects, and brushless motors ensure efficiency. However, battery weight can make the tool heavier, and cold temperatures may reduce battery performance. If portability and convenience outweigh the need for continuous, heavy-duty use, a cordless nailer is the better fit.
Consider the trade-offs in maintenance and cost. Pneumatic nailers have fewer moving parts, making them generally more durable and less prone to electronic failure. They’re also typically more affordable upfront, though the cost of a compressor can offset this advantage. Cordless models require battery replacements over time, and their initial price is higher due to advanced technology. Evaluate your long-term needs and budget before deciding.
For DIYers or occasional users, a cordless 15-gauge finish nailer provides flexibility without the hassle of compressor setup. Professionals working on large, repetitive projects may prefer the reliability and power of a pneumatic model. Test both types if possible to determine which aligns best with your work style and project requirements. Ultimately, the choice depends on balancing power, portability, and practicality for your specific tasks.

Battery Life and Power Efficiency
Battery life is a critical factor when selecting a 15-gauge finish nailer, especially for professionals who rely on uninterrupted workflow. Lithium-ion batteries dominate this category, offering a balance of weight and power. Look for models with 2.0 Ah to 4.0 Ah battery capacities, as these provide sufficient runtime for most finishing tasks without adding excessive weight. For instance, a 3.0 Ah battery can typically drive 1,000 to 1,500 nails on a single charge, depending on the tool’s efficiency and nail density. Always opt for nailers with brushless motors, as they consume less energy and extend battery life by up to 50% compared to brushed models.
Power efficiency isn’t just about runtime; it’s also about consistent performance. A nailer with a smart battery management system ensures power delivery remains stable, even as the battery drains. This prevents misfires or under-driven nails, which can compromise finish quality. For example, some nailers feature "fade-free" technology, maintaining peak power until the battery is nearly depleted. If you’re working on delicate trim or cabinetry, this consistency is non-negotiable. Pair your nailer with a fast charger—ideally one that recharges a 3.0 Ah battery in 30 minutes or less—to minimize downtime.
When comparing models, consider the tool’s power-to-weight ratio. A lightweight nailer (under 5 lbs) with a high-efficiency motor can deliver the same driving force as a heavier model while conserving energy. For instance, the DEWALT DCN660D1 uses a compact brushless motor to achieve this balance, making it a top choice for extended use. Conversely, heavier nailers with larger batteries may offer longer runtime but can fatigue users over time. Assess your project scale: for small to medium tasks, prioritize efficiency; for large projects, focus on battery capacity and quick-charging capabilities.
Practical tip: Always carry a spare battery, especially if you’re working in remote locations or on time-sensitive projects. Some manufacturers offer multi-voltage batteries compatible with their entire lineup, allowing you to share power sources across tools. Additionally, store batteries in a cool, dry place and avoid letting them fully discharge, as this can reduce their lifespan. By optimizing battery life and power efficiency, you ensure your 15-gauge finish nailer remains a reliable partner in precision work.

Weight and Ergonomics for Comfort
A 15-gauge finish nailer’s weight directly impacts user fatigue, especially during extended projects. Most models range from 3.5 to 6 pounds, with lighter options like the Metabo HPT NT65M2A (3.9 lbs) offering maneuverability for overhead work or tight spaces. Heavier models, such as the DeWalt DCN650D1 (5.5 lbs), often incorporate magnesium bodies to balance durability with weight reduction. For professionals, a tool under 5 pounds is ideal, while hobbyists may tolerate slightly heavier designs if they prioritize features like depth adjustment or jam clearance.
Ergonomics extend beyond weight to grip design and vibration control. Look for nailers with rubberized, contoured handles that distribute pressure evenly across the palm, reducing strain during repetitive firing. The Senco FinishPro 42XP exemplifies this with its ergonomic grip and low vibration, thanks to a lightweight aluminum magazine and tuned exhaust system. Avoid models with sharp edges or hard plastic grips, as these accelerate discomfort over time. A well-designed grip can extend usable hours by 20–30% compared to inferior designs.
Balance is another critical ergonomic factor, particularly in tools with angled magazines. Rear-loading models like the Bostitch N62FNK-2 position the center of gravity closer to the user’s hand, enhancing control during precision work. Conversely, front-loading designs may shift weight forward, requiring more wrist effort. Test the tool’s balance by holding it horizontally for 30 seconds—if your forearm tires quickly, the weight distribution is likely suboptimal.
For comfort in prolonged use, consider nailers with adjustable belts or rafter hooks to minimize carrying strain. The Porter-Cable FN250B includes a reversible belt hook, allowing users to switch sides based on dominance or task. Additionally, tools with tool-free jam release and adjustable exhaust ports reduce interruptions and awkward repositioning, further preserving comfort. Always pair the nailer with a properly fitted air hose to avoid unnecessary drag, which can offset the benefits of a lightweight tool.
Ultimately, the best 15-gauge finish nailer for comfort combines a weight under 5 pounds, a contoured grip, balanced design, and user-friendly features. Prioritize hands-on testing if possible, as individual preferences vary. For instance, a carpenter with smaller hands might favor the compact Makita AF635 over bulkier alternatives. By focusing on these ergonomic details, users can significantly reduce physical stress and improve productivity, ensuring the tool becomes an asset rather than a burden.

Nail Capacity and Loading Ease
A 15-gauge finish nailer’s nail capacity directly impacts workflow efficiency, determining how often you’ll need to pause for reloads. Most models hold between 100 to 120 nails in their magazines, striking a balance between compactness and reduced downtime. For larger projects, such as crown molding or paneling, a higher capacity minimizes interruptions, while smaller jobs may prioritize a lighter tool with fewer nails. Always check the magazine’s compatibility with nail lengths, typically ranging from 1-1/4 to 2-1/2 inches, to ensure seamless operation.
Loading ease is equally critical, as a cumbersome process can slow progress and increase frustration. Look for nailers with a quick-load or side-load mechanism, which allows nails to slide in smoothly without binding or misalignment. Some models feature a "last nail lockout" function, preventing dry firing by locking the trigger when nails are depleted—a small detail that protects both the tool and workpiece. Practice loading a few times before starting a project to familiarize yourself with the process and avoid jams.
Comparing loading systems, rear-load designs are traditional but can be bulkier, while side-load models offer better visibility and accessibility. For instance, the DEWALT DWFP12231 uses a rear-load system with a generous 100-nail capacity, while the Metabo HPT NT65M2S (formerly Hitachi) employs a side-load design for quicker reloads. Your choice should align with project scale and personal preference for handling.
To maximize efficiency, preload multiple nail strips before beginning work, especially for time-sensitive tasks. Keep nails stored in a dry environment to prevent rust or debris from causing jams during loading. If a jam occurs, clear it immediately to avoid damaging the magazine or driver blade. Regularly inspect the loading channel for burrs or debris, using compressed air or a soft brush for maintenance.
Ultimately, nail capacity and loading ease are intertwined features that influence productivity. A tool that holds enough nails for your task and loads effortlessly will save time and reduce physical strain. Prioritize models with intuitive loading mechanisms and capacities tailored to your project size, ensuring the nailer becomes an asset, not an obstacle, in your workflow.

Depth Adjustment and Precision Control
Depth adjustment is a critical feature in a 15-gauge finish nailer, allowing users to control how deeply the nail is driven into the material. This precision ensures a professional finish, preventing nails from protruding or sinking too far below the surface. Most high-quality nailers offer a tool-free depth adjustment mechanism, often a dial or wheel, enabling quick changes on the fly. For instance, when working with hardwoods, a shallower setting avoids splitting, while softer materials like pine may require a deeper drive for secure fastening. Understanding this feature is essential for achieving consistent results across various projects.
To maximize precision control, consider the material thickness and density before adjusting the depth. Start by testing the nailer on a scrap piece of the same material to fine-tune the setting. A common rule of thumb is to ensure the nail head sits flush with the surface, leaving no gaps or excess pressure marks. For delicate trim work, incremental adjustments—often as small as 1/16-inch—can make a significant difference. Advanced models may include a depth gauge or indicator, providing visual feedback for added accuracy.
One often-overlooked aspect of depth adjustment is its role in minimizing damage to the workpiece. Overdriving nails can dent or crack delicate materials, while underdriving compromises structural integrity. For example, when attaching baseboards, a precise depth setting ensures the nail holds firmly without marring the wood. Pairing depth adjustment with a consistent driving force, often controlled by air pressure, further enhances control. Aim for 80–90 PSI for most applications, adjusting as needed based on material hardness.
Comparing models, some 15-gauge nailers offer additional precision features like sequential or contact actuation modes. Sequential firing, where the trigger and nose must be pressed in order, provides better control for detailed work. Contact actuation, ideal for speed, requires careful depth adjustment to avoid errors. For instance, the DEWALT DWFP12231 combines both modes with a precise depth adjustment system, making it a top choice for professionals. Ultimately, mastering depth adjustment transforms a good finish nailer into an indispensable tool for flawless craftsmanship.

A: Yes, a 15 gauge finish nailer is ideal for trim work, as it provides stronger holding power compared to 16 or 18 gauge nailers, making it suitable for baseboards, crown molding, and other trim applications.
A 15 gauge finish nailer uses thicker nails, offering greater strength and holding power, while a 16 gauge nailer uses thinner nails that leave smaller holes, making it better for delicate trim work with less visible marks.
